## Onboarding: Telemetry Payload Compression

All Quillbrook agents compress telemetry with zstd before upload. Dictionary files rotate weekly; the release manager approves each rotation. Do not ship a build with a stale dictionary — decompression fails silently on the ingest tier and metrics vanish. Verify the dictionary hash in the release checklist. If the rotation pipeline stalls, unlock the fallback dictionary store using the recovery passphrase below.

recovery phrase for bawef-haduf: wenax-druox-julmir

## Artifact Signing — Telemetry Compression

Flintrow telemetry payloads are compressed with zstd level 9 before upload to the Harkness collector. Compression runs in the agent; the collector verifies a signature over the compressed blob, not the plaintext. Dictionary updates ship as signed artifacts through the Vexbridge pipeline. Verification failures drop the payload silently. All artifacts are signed with the key below.

signing key of fajop-tahop = bky9_qdL6xeDv7

## Further Reading

The user module is being split out of the Harkwell monolith into the Identity service. Before touching auth, sessions, or profile code, read the migration plan — dual-write is active and ordering matters. Skip the old ADRs; they're superseded. Questions go to the Identity guild channel. The current migration plan and cutover timeline are on the internal architecture page.

runbook for badug-kadup: https://confluence.zemvarlabs.internal/projects/browse/display/projects/bd1b